Water Softeners

A water softener uses salt to remove minerals and odours from hard water (usually calcium and magnesium). Water softener systems use resin beads that attract and attach sodium ions in the softener tank. Pumps push hard water through the resin beads, exchanging hardness ions with sodium ions, softening the water. Having hard water in your home can affect the lifespan of any water appliance due to the excess of calcium and magnesium. A common side effect of having hard water in your home is dryness of skin or hair. If you’re unhappy with the taste of your tap water there is a good chance you’re unhappy with the taste of chlorine (city water is cleaned with chlorine). You can pair a softener with a chlorine filter to improve the taste of tap water.
